From 65c87982e7740722bc20aeff60d67f255ed5925e Mon Sep 17 00:00:00 2001 From: Jonathan Naylor Date: Mon, 20 Mar 2017 14:42:04 +0000 Subject: [PATCH] Disable network reading when not linked. --- YSFGateway/Network.cpp |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/YSFGateway/Network.cpp b/YSFGateway/Network.cpp index 915b29b..02945a2 100644 --- a/YSFGateway/Network.cpp +++ b/YSFGateway/Network.cpp @@ -1,5 +1,5 @@ /* - * Copyright (C) 2009-2014,2016 by Jonathan Naylor G4KLX + * Copyright (C) 2009-2014,2016,2017 by Jonathan Naylor G4KLX * * This program is free software; you can redistribute it and/or modify * it under the terms of the GNU General Public License as published by @@ -130,6 +130,9 @@ bool CNetwork::writeUnlink() void CNetwork::clock(unsigned int ms) { + if (m_port == 0U) + return; + unsigned char buffer[BUFFER_LENGTH]; in_addr address;